Average Aviation Inspector Salary in Lesotho for 2026
An aviation inspector in Lesotho earns about 172,200 LSL a year. That's 24% above the national average of 138,800 LSL.
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Lesotho sit around 84,180 LSL a year, while the very top stretches to 272,800 LSL. How aviation inspector pay ranges in Lesotho
A good way to think about salary in Lesotho is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all aviation inspectors in Lesotho earn less than 175,900 LSL a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".
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 119,560 LSL (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 227,600 LSL (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of aviation inspectors s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.
The very lowest reported salaries sit around 84,180 LSL. The highest stretch to 272,800 LSL,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. Aviation inspector pay by experience in Lesotho
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for an aviation inspector in Lesotho,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ical aviation inspector salary changes as you move through the career ladder.
- 0-2 Years101,900 LSL
- 2-5 Years+26% from previous128,500 LSL
- 5-10 Years+40% from previous180,300 LSL
- 10-15 Years+23% from previous222,300 LSL
- 15-20 Years+8% from previous239,000 LSL
- 20+ Years+6% from previous252,300 LSL
The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 40%. That is the point at which a aviation inspector typ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Pay raises for an aviation inspector in Lesotho
Most countries hand out at least some kind of pay raise every year, typically when an employee's contract is reviewed or as a cost-of-living adjustment to keep wages roughly in step with inflation. The rhythm and size of those raises varies hugely between industries.
A typical worker doing this role in Lesotho sees a raise of about 8% every 28 months, which works out to roughly 3% on an annual basis. That figure is the typical underlying rate; in years where inflation runs high you can usually expect a bit more, and in flat-economy years a bit less.
Across all jobs in Lesotho, the national average raise is around 5% every 28 months.

Aviation inspector bonus rates in Lesotho
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.
39% of aviation inspectors in Lesotho re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es an aviation inspector a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.
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 3% to 6% of base salary. The remaining 61% of aviation inspectors reported no bonus at all over the same period.
